Leukocytosis

Basics

Description

Definition:

  • Any elevation of total number of white blood cells (WBCs) beyond expected value
  • Leukocytosis is one of the most common lab abnormalities (found in 17% of ED patients in whom a CBC is checked)
  • Normal range for total WBCs (/mm3):
    • Adults: 4500–11,000
    • Children: WBC count decreases with age:
      • Infant, 1 wk old: 5000–21,000
      • Toddler, 1 yr old: 6000–17,500
      • Child, 4 yr old: 5500–15,500
    • Pregnancy:
      • 1st trimester: 5000–14,000
      • 2nd trimester: 5000–15,000
      • 3rd trimester: 5000–17,000
  • Normal ranges shift slightly upward with:
    • Exercise
    • Female gender
    • Smoking
    • Daytime hours
  • Given wide range of normal values, numbers must be interpreted in clinical context
  • Specific subsets:
  • Neutrophil predominance (neutrophilia):
    • Absolute neutrophil count >7500/mm3
    • Half of circulating neutrophils are adherent to blood vessel walls. They can be rapidly released (demarginate) in response to acute stressors. This can double the WBC count
    • An additional pool of mature neutrophils, immature metamyelocytes, and band neutrophils are stored in the bone marrow. These can be released, increasing the neutrophil count, typically during inflammation or infection. Release of immature forms results in a “left shift”
  • Lymphocyte predominance (lymphocytosis):
    • Absolute lymphocyte count >4000/mm3
    • Stored in the spleen, lymph nodes, thymus, and bone marrow. They are typically released in response to foreign antigens or viral infections
  • Leukemoid reaction (WBC >50,000/mm3):
    • Increased neutrophils or lymphocytes, occurs in response to disease/stress must be distinguished from hematologic malignancy
  • Hyperleukocytosis (WBC >100,000/mm3):
    • Seen primarily in hematologic malignancies
    • Can be associated with leukostasis, disseminated intravascular coagulopathy (DIC), and tumor lysis syndrome
  • Leukostasis
    • Impaired microvascular blood flow from increased viscosity with high concentration of malignant cells
    • Most commonly effects pulmonary, brain microcirculation
    • Most commonly seen in AML

Etiology

  • Neutrophilia:
    • Demargination/stress reaction:
      • Stress
      • Exercise
      • Surgery
      • Seizures
      • Trauma
      • Hypoxia
      • Pain
      • Panic attacks
      • Vomiting
    • Inflammation:
      • Rheumatoid arthritis
      • Gout
      • Inflammatory bowel disease
      • Vasculitis
    • Infection, generally bacterial:
      • Diarrhea consider C. difficile, shigella
    • Lab error
    • Labor
    • Leukemoid reaction (TB, Hodgkin, sepsis, metastasis)
    • Medications:
      • β-Agonist (epinephrine, cocaine, albuterol)
      • Corticosteroids
      • Lithium
      • Granulocyte colony–stimulating factor
    • Metabolic disorders:
      • DKA
      • Thyrotoxicosis
      • Uremia
    • Malignancy, nonhematogenous
    • Myeloproliferative neoplasm:
      • Myelofibrosis
      • Essential thrombocythemia
      • Polycythemia vera
      • Chronic myelogenous leukemia
    • Pregnancy
    • Rapid RBC turnover:
      • Hemorrhage
      • Hemolysis
    • Smoking
    • Tissue necrosis:
      • Cancer
      • Burns
      • Infarction
  • Lymphocytosis:
    • Infection, generally viral, early stages:
      • Infectious mononucleosis
      • VZV
      • CMV
      • Viral hepatitis
    • Infection bacterial, specifically:
      • Pertussis
      • TB
      • Syphilis
      • Rickettsia
      • Babesia
      • Bartonella
    • Hematologic malignancy/lymphoproliferative disorders:
      • Acute lymphocytic leukemia
      • Chronic lymphocytic leukemia
      • Non-Hodgkin lymphoma
    • Hypothyroidism
    • Immunologic responses:
      • Immunization
      • Autoimmune diseases
      • Graft rejection
    • Splenectomy
  • Monocytosis:
    • Infection:
      • EBV
      • Fungal
      • Protozoa
    • Autoimmune/rheumatologic disorders
    • Splenectomy
  • Eosinophilia:
    • Infection, primarily parasitic and fungal
    • Allergic disorders:
      • Allergic rhinitis
      • Asthma
      • Drug reaction/hypersensitivity
    • Hematologic malignancy
    • Connective tissue disease
  • Basophilia:
    • Allergic disorders
    • Hematologic malignancy
